Quick Answer
To reset a Shark Robot Vacuum, first ensure that the vacuum is turned on. Then, locate the reset button on the underside of the device and press and hold it for 10-15 seconds. Release the button and wait for the vacuum to restart, which indicates that it has been successfully reset. Performing a hard reset

Performing a hard reset is an easy way to troubleshoot problems with your Shark Robot Vacuum. This process will erase all of the settings and schedule information that you have saved on your vacuum. Once the reset is complete, you will have to set the time and schedule again.

To perform a hard reset, begin by turning off the power switch on the Shark Robot Vacuum. Next, press and hold the power button on the vacuum for 10 seconds. Release the button when the status light turns off. Finally, turn the power switch back on, and your vacuum should be reset. If the problem persists after the reset, you may need to contact customer support for further assistance. Checking for software updates

Checking for software updates

It is important to regularly check for software updates for your Shark robot vacuum as it can improve your vacuum’s performance and fix any bugs that may be present. To check for updates, first ensure that your vacuum is connected to your home Wi-Fi network. Once connected, navigate to the SharkClean app on your smartphone, and click on the ‘Settings’ icon. From there, click on ‘Check for Updates’ to see if there are any available software updates for your vacuum.

If there is an update available, follow the on-screen instructions to start the update. Make sure that your vacuum is plugged in and has a fully charged battery before starting the update process. Depending on the size of the update, it may take several minutes to complete. Once the update has finished, your vacuum will restart and you can resume using it as usual. Resetting Wi-Fi connection settings

Resetting the Wi-Fi connection settings of your Shark robot vacuum is an important step especially if you have recently changed your Wi-Fi credentials, or the robot is not connecting to the internet as it should. There are two methods to reset the Wi-Fi connection settings, which are the “forget network” and “factory reset” methods.

The “forget network” method is recommended if you only need to reset the Wi-Fi credentials without resetting the entire robot. Simply go to the Wi-Fi settings on your phone or tablet, locate the Shark robot network, tap “forget network” to remove it from the list. From there, go back to the SharkClean app on your device, add your new Wi-Fi credentials, and connect to the network again. On the other hand, the “factory reset” method means resetting the entire robot back to its default settings. To carry out this method, hold down the dock and spot buttons simultaneously until you hear a tone. This will remove all settings and data, and you will have to set up the robot once again from scratch.
